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The mission of greenagers is simply stated: youth working to strengthen the enviornment and our community.

Greenagers provides employment and volunteer opportunities for teens and young adults in the fields of conservation, sustainable farming, and environmental leadership. Through vocational-environmental programs and community engagement, greenagers prepares youth for success in their education and work.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4A

Conservation (approximately 70 youth employed annually) trail crews: in the berkshires and nearby new york state, our trail crews maintain existing trails and build new trails for the appalachian trail conservancy, trustees of reservations, columbia land conservancy and other conservation organizations. Crew members work on crews of 6-8 youth and one crew leader. Over the course of the season, crew members learn the skills necessary to the various jobs with which they are tasked; acquire knowledge and familiarity with the tools and vocabulary required to accomplish the work; receive on-site training by community specialists; connect with community conservation partners; discover new areas of the berkshires and columbia county to explore and appreciate; and earn money - this is a real job with a starting wage of 12.75 (2020). River walk stewards: the river walk stewardship program connects apprentices with a unique national recreation trail, a greenway along the scenic housatonic river in great barrington, ma. Apprentices take care of weekly maintenance on the trail, help lead group tours and volunteer days, and receive training and mentorship by river walk's on-staff horticulturalist and greenagers' conservation staff.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4B

Agriculture (averaging 10-20 youth employed and 100 plus families served annually) april hill farm and farm crew: at april hill conservation and education center (acquired february 2019) we are creating a farm that showcases regenerative agriculture. Regenerative farming uses techniques that are responsive to climate change, that improve the health of the soil, and that teach young adults' methods for small and medium scale agriculture that will increase the amount of nutrient-dense food available to all demographics. The farm at april hill creates multiple opportunities for youth employment and enrichment. The apprentice and crew members work under the tutelage of our head farmer to maintain the farms vegetable and flower gardens, and its orchards. Additionally, they attend to the care and keeping of bees, chickens, and ducks. The produce grown benefits local health centers and food pantries.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4C

Education (engages approximately 150 youth annually) climate action: with greenagers staff, middle schoolers from local public schools venture outdoors to explore, engage, and ultimately give back to the environment and community in this after-school and summertime environmental education program. We encourage students to make more informed decisions about how they treat the world around them through hands-on activities involving climate change education, nature observation and appreciation, and service-learning projects for those within the community and our international neighbors. Workshops: greenagers hosts a variety of workshops each year, with a focus on farming and gardening; sustainable building; and traditional skills and arts. Volunteer days, school visits, and open tours: greenagers is developing site-specific curricula for april hill to augment our current education programs for local youth and create programming for visiting schools and youth. With 100 acres of diverse habitat, greenagers welcomes rural, suburban, and urban youth to hands-on activities and service projects to foster deeper connections with our environment. Visits range from half a day to a week.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4D

Agriculture front lawn food and food sovereignty crew: the front lawn food program, in collaboration with berkshire community action council, encourages local families to grow their own organic vegetables. Garden beds are constructed and installed by greenagers staff and youth, with summertime advice and periodic garden check-ins available to garden owners. For every garden sold, a garden is donated to a local family in need.
